This 2013 blog post from the Open Education Database's iLibrarian Blog lists over 250 digital archives and collections from around the United States. The collection focuses mostly on localized and regional libraries that provide open access to anyone. It also includes larger collections and archives focused on U.S. History. The collections and archives are organized alphabetically by state, starting with all the resources in Alabama and proceeding to Wyoming. For researchers looking for new resources or readers who love browsing archives, this resource from iLibrarian will open up a world of documents, archival footage an photographs, and primary texts.
